What antitrust law means for real cases in Jakobstad

In Jakobstad, antitrust (Finnish: kilpailuoikeus) typically shows up in everyday business conduct: pricing coordination, tenders, market-sharing, and misuse of market power. While many matters involve national investigations, local companies feel the impact through procurement, supplier relationships, and contract review.

Jakobstad has a strong mix of manufacturing, trade, construction, and services. Antitrust risk often arises in these sectors when competitors align bidding strategies for local or regional customers, exchange sensitive information through associations, or impose exclusive dealing that locks out rivals.

Most enforcement in Finland is handled at national level, but local businesses in Jakobstad face practical steps like responding to information requests, managing evidence, and assessing whether a complaint or leniency application could affect their position.

Why you may need an antitrust lawyer

Tender coordination in municipal or large buyer procurement: If a company suspects competitors agreed on bids for contracts used by local operators in Jakobstad, legal help is needed to assess exposure and protect documentation.

Information exchange via associations or industry meetings: In smaller business communities, conversations can drift toward commercially sensitive topics. Counsel can help structure compliant communication and respond to later allegations.

Resale price or distribution restrictions: If suppliers impose price floors, minimum advertised pricing, or strict territory rules, antitrust review is often required for distribution contracts used in Jakobstad.

Exclusive supply or customer lock-in: Exclusive dealing, long notice periods, or loyalty-like rebates may raise concerns where a company has market power in a local niche.

Abuse of a dominant position: Complaints can arise from refusal to supply, discriminatory terms, or tying practices involving key inputs or interfaces for customers in the region.

Leniency, settlement pressure, or follow-on damages: After an investigation begins, timing is critical for leniency, evidence preservation, and evaluating the risk of customer or competitor claims.

Local laws and rules that matter in Finland

Finnish Competition Act (Kilpailulaki) 948/2011 (in force from 1 January 2012): This is the core statute for prohibiting anticompetitive agreements and abuse of dominance. It governs enforcement by Finnish authorities and procedural rules for investigations and decisions.

EU competition law: Treaty on the Functioning of the European Union (TFEU) Articles 101 and 102: These apply directly where agreements or conduct affect trade between Member States. In practice, Finnish cases in Jakobstad can involve EU law alongside national law.

Council Regulation (EC) No 1/2003: This provides the framework for applying Articles 101 and 102, including investigatory and enforcement cooperation within the EU system.

Frequently asked questions

Do I need a lawyer for an antitrust complaint in Jakobstad?

Not always, but a lawyer is often advisable when the complaint relates to bid rigging, market allocation, or pricing coordination. Antitrust matters can require rapid evidence collection and careful statements to authorities and counterparties.

How does an antitrust investigation start in Finland?

An investigation typically begins when the Finnish competition authority conducts inquiries, receives information, or acts on a complaint or market signals. Companies may receive requests for information or documents and must respond within set deadlines.

What costs should be expected for antitrust legal help in Finland?

Costs depend on scope, urgency, and whether the matter is advisory, investigative, or contested. In Finland, fees are frequently set by hourly rates or case fees, and early-stage guidance can be cheaper than litigation.

Is leniency available for companies accused of cartel conduct?

Leniency is generally possible in Finland under the EU and Finnish cartel enforcement framework. Leniency can reduce penalties, but eligibility depends on timing and the information provided, so early legal assessment is important.

How fast do deadlines move once a company receives an information request?

Deadlines can be short, especially for document production and management interviews. Delayed or incomplete responses can harm credibility and increase the risk of adverse inferences.

Can an antitrust issue be resolved without court litigation in Finland?

Often, yes. Authorities can issue decisions after investigation, and parties can sometimes settle commercial disputes separately. Criminal proceedings are different and generally not the main route for typical competition infringements.

What evidence is most important in antitrust cases?

Internal emails, meeting notes, pricing models, tender files, and messaging records are commonly central. Consistent witness accounts and documentary timelines often determine whether conduct appears coordinated or accidental.

Are standard business meetings always risky under competition rules?

Meetings are not automatically problematic, but discussing sensitive topics can create risk. Proper agendas, limited participation, and clear minutes can reduce exposure when communication is necessary.

Does antitrust apply to distribution and agency agreements used in Jakobstad?

Yes, distribution terms, exclusivity, and pricing-related clauses can raise antitrust questions. The legality depends on market position, contract structure, and whether restrictions go beyond what is permitted.

What if a contract signed years ago is now challenged?

Authorities and private claimers can challenge conduct based on when effects occurred and the relevant legal framework. Lawyers can review timelines, limitation periods, and evidence retention options.

Can a company be sued by customers for antitrust harm in Finland?

In many situations, follow-on claims may be possible after an authority decision. Even before a final decision, disputes about damages can arise, so early risk analysis matters.

How do I compare antitrust lawyers in Finland?

Look for experience with competition authority investigations, cartel exposure, and EU law alignment. Request an approach for evidence handling, communications strategy, and whether the lawyer coordinates with procurement, compliance, or litigation counsel.

Official resources for antitrust help in Jakobstad

  • Finnish Competition and Consumer Authority (Kilpailu- ja kuluttajavirasto, FRC or KKV): The main Finnish authority for investigating and enforcing competition law, including antitrust matters and information requests.
  • European Commission, Directorate-General for Competition: For EU-level antitrust enforcement and guidance where cases involve EU-wide implications.
  • National legislation resources (Finlex): The official database for Finnish statutes, including the Finnish Competition Act and related implementing rules.

Next steps to find and hire the right antitrust lawyer

  1. Identify the trigger and risk type (tender bid issue, suspected cartel, distribution restriction, or dominance complaint). Write down dates and the exact conduct that is alleged.
  2. Preserve evidence immediately for the relevant period, including emails, tender documents, spreadsheets, call logs, and chat exports. Stop routine overwriting where possible.
  3. Book an initial consultation with an antitrust-focused lawyer and request a document-focused case assessment. Aim to complete this within 3 to 7 days if an investigation is already underway.
  4. Ask about investigation support such as handling information requests, interview strategies, and communications with the authority. Confirm whether the lawyer coordinates with EU competition counsel if EU law issues are likely.
  5. Clarify scope and fee structure in writing, including whether the work is advisory, investigative support, or litigation risk management. Request a timeline for key steps and expected deliverables.
  6. Discuss leniency or settlement positioning if cartel exposure is involved. A careful eligibility and timing review should be prioritized in the first 1 to 2 weeks.
  7. Evaluate practical communication and compliance outcomes such as implementing meeting guidelines and contract review for ongoing operations in Jakobstad. Use these as selection criteria alongside legal expertise.
